Im Englischen können Verben regelmäßig und unregelmäßig sein. Regelmäßige Verben bilden die Vergangenheitsform und das Partizip Perfekt nach der Standardregel: mit der Hinzufügung von „-ed“. Unregelmäßige Verben haben ihre eigenen einzigartigen Formen, die auswendig gelernt werden müssen. Es gibt nur etwa 200 unregelmäßige Verben im Englischen, aber nur etwa 100 davon werden aktiv im Sprachgebrauch verwendet.
